Common Mold Remediation Scams in Hungerford
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ators
Bait-and-Switch Pricing
Lowball inspection fee, then claim massive mold infestation needing thousands extra.
Fake Mold Detection
Use bogus tests to 'find' hidden mold everywhere, pushing full-house remediation.
Shoddy or Incomplete Work
Surface cleaning only; mold regrows, scammer returns for more cash.
Upfront Payment Demands
Insist on full or large deposits before any work, then vanish.
How to Verify a Professional
Insurance
Request a Certificate of Insurance (COI) for general liability and workers' comp. Call the insurer to verify coverage amounts and expiration.
Licensing
Check Texas contractor licenses via the TDLR website (tdlr.texas.gov). Confirm certifications from IICRC, RIA, or NORMI for mold expertise—ask for proof.
References
Get 3 recent local references from Hungerford or Wharton County. Call to ask about work quality, timeliness, and if mold returned.
